Teewe 2 Wireless HDMI Media Streaming Dongle Launched at Rs. 2,399

Mango Man Consumer Electronics, which launched Teewe last year, is back with an upgraded version of the HDMI media streaming dongle. The Teewe 2 has been launched in India at Rs. 2,399.

The company has announced that the Teewe 2 will be available exclusively at Amazon India from Monday next week. The HDMI dongle can be pre-ordered from Tuesday via the company's official site. For pre-order customers, the company is offering an additional 1 year of warranty with the Teewe media streaming stick.

The company has also announced partnerships with ErosNow, which will offer two months of free ErosNow premium subscription including content from Indian entertainment to Teewe 2 users, and Airtel, will offer 20GB per month of free data for three consecutive months. The company in a press statement announced that the ErosNow partnership will go live soon.

The Teewe 2 HDMI media streaming dongle features a dual-core ARM Cortex-A9 processor clocked at 1.6GHz; a quad-core GPU; 1GB of RAM, and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n support. It can be connected to any TV with an HDMI port.

The company touts that the Teewe 2 is 30 percent smaller in size compared to the first-generation Teewe.

Commenting on the launch, Sai Srinivas, CEO, Teewe said, "We are very excited to launch the next version of Teewe with upgraded hardware for a better overall experience. Through this device, the customer can take advantage of the largest screen in the house to display and share his/her personalized content, be it from the internet or from his/her device. We are also thrilled to partner with Eros to bring its wide selection of premium Indian content."

The Indian market has lately seen some launches happening in streaming dongle segment with the popularity increasing with Google's Chromecast release late last year.
